Slammers trump Smokers

  • Published: 1/12/2009 at 12:00 AM
  • Newspaper section: Sports

SAMRONG : The Penalty Spot Slammers scored late in the third period then early in overtime to knock off the Roadhouse Smokers 4-3 in high-tempo Thai-World Hockey League action.

In game one, the DPelican Inn Flyers broke the game open in the final frame to defeat the BNH Hospital Blades 4-1 on Sunday and keep a three-game winning streak alive.

Smokers Tawin Chartsuwan , captain Joe Doan, and Jason Tuckett tallied.

Slammers blue-liner Ralf Dittmer corralled a puck at the blue line and blasted a seething slap shot through the goalies five-hole.

Netminder Lance Parker, finishing with 30 saves, stymied two breakaway attempts with the Slammers pressing to tie the game, his nicest a sprawling glove save on what looked to be a sure goal.

In OT, Pasit Jirachai stripped the Smokers defenceman of the puck, streaked down the ice alone, and blazed a hard wrist shot into the low corner of the net for the winner.

Earlier Oscar Sala fired a loose puck in to get the Flyers on the board, but Blades captain Todd Switzer replied quickly on a two-on-one with a hard wrister through the wickets.

Anun Kulligan scored on an end-to-end solo dash, Scott Murray roofed the puck, and Michael White fired a shot top shelf to put the final nail in the Blades coffin.
